On April 23, 2023, at approximately 2 a.m., a tragic incident occurred at Trap Up Studio, a hookah bar and lounge located on Hill Avenue in South Nashville. The establishment's DJ, 27-year-old David Bickham, was found deceased at the scene. Another individual, 26-year-old Tarrell Grant, sustained serious gunshot wounds and was transported to Vanderbilt University Medical Center, where he later succumbed to his injuries.
Preliminary investigations by the Metro Nashville Police Departmen
...Read More